On 17/06/2019 15:49:55+0100, Russell King wrote:
> The GPIO interrupt controllers are missing their required
> #interrupt-cells property, which prevents GPIO interrupts being
> specified in DT.
>
> Signed-off-by: Russell King <rmk+kernel@armlinux•org.uk>
Reviewed-by: Alexandre Belloni <alexandre.belloni@bootlin•com>
> ---
> ar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-cp110.dtsi | 2 ++
> 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)
>
> di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-cp110.dtsi b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-cp110.dtsi
> index 4d6e4a097f72..f71afb1de18f 100644
> ---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-cp110.dtsi
> +++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-cp110.dtsi
> @@ -238,6 +238,7 @@
> <85 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>,
> <84 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>,
> <83 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
> + #interrupt-cells = <2>;
> status = "disabled";
> };
>
> @@ -253,6 +254,7 @@
> <81 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>,
> <80 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>,
> <79 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
> + #interrupt-cells = <2>;
> status = "disabled";
> };
> };
